On the second week of February world’s leading meeting place for Scandinavian design – Stockholm Furniture and Light Fair 2018 – took place. The fair filled a space as big as 40 000 square meters with the freshest interior and lighting innovations. Oot-Oot visited the fair and checked out which new products, materials, economic and technological solutions have been brought on the design market.

Radis is an Estonian furniture design and production company, all of its products are made from birch plywood and oilwaxed with different tones. At Tallinn Furniture Fair Radis presented brand new items. Most popular was the extendable dinner table NAM-NAM.

Pivoting around a metal point, Corian rings shape a wonderful modern sink called the Orbit Sink. Imagined by industrial designer Alessandro Isola as a contemporary design alternative that brightens up spaces with its sleek elegance, this exciting sink design draws inspiration from the simplicity of a cylinder.
The new advertising agency office design for Wieden+Kennedy New York takes the “playground” tone down a notch only to focus on work-related necessities without forgetting aesthetics. Well known for their work with Nike, Wieden+Kennedy New York’s offices were recently updated to suit their employees’ and company’s needs. The agency’s new 50,000 square feet New York offices flaunt a rounded walnut-clad staircase connecting two of the three floors.
